Descriptives -Central tendency, dispersion, distribution and Z scores.Descriptive ratio statistics - Coefficient of dispersion,Coefficient of variation, price-related differential and averageAbsolute deviance. Frequencies - Counts,Percentages, valid and cumulative percentages central tendency,Dispersion, distribution and percentile values. Includes these statistical tests:Crosstabulations - Counts, percentages, residuals, marginals,Tests of independence, test of linear association, measure ofLinear association, and much more. Includes twoAdd-ons in addition to the full version of SPSS Base: AdvancedStatistics and Regression.TwoStep Cluster Analysis - Group observations intoClusters based on nearness criterion, with either categorical orContinuous level data. Hierarchical ClusterCases. K-means ClusterAnalysis - Used to identify relatively homogeneous groups ofCases based on selected characteristics. Explore - Confidence intervals for means M-estimators Identification of outliers plotting of findings. Nonparametric tests- Chi-square, Binomial, Runs, one-sample, two independentSamples, k-independent samples, two related samples, k-relatedSamples. Correlation - Test forBivariate or partial correlation, or for distances indicatingSimilarity or dissimilarity between measures.
